Foil Baked salmon

Ingredients:

1 ½ lb piece of salmon fillet or 4 , 6 ounce pieces

Chopped garlic

Grated ginger

Half a lemon

Method :

First take a sheet of foil large enough to wrap the fish in, and lay it over a shallow baking tin.

Wipe the pieces of salmon with kitchen paper and place on the foil. Then place the chopped garlic, grated ginger and juice of half a lemon over the fish and season with salt and pepper.

Then bring the foil up either side, then pleat it, fold it over and seal it at the sides. .Pull the foil in the middle to tent over the fish

All this can be done in advance, but when you need to cook the salmon, pre-heat the oven to gas mark 4, 350°F (180°C) and bake the salmon on a high-ish oven shelf for 20 minutes exactly.
